    Background
    Potassium channels are present in most mammalian cells, where they participate in a wide range of physiologic responses. KCNJ5 is an integral membrane protein and inward-rectifier type potassium channel. KCNJ5, which has a greater tendency to allow potassium to flow into a cell rather than out of a cell, is controlled by G-proteins. It may associate with two other G-protein-activated potassium channels to form a heteromultimeric pore-forming complex.Potassium channels are present in most mammalian cells, where they participate in a wide range of physiologic responses.
